WAYNE, N.J. – William Paterson's men's swimming & diving team (4-3) earned their fourth-straight victory, defeating visiting Division II Adelphi (2-2), 135-103, Dec. 8.
Senior
Sebastian Schrils (Washington, N.J./Warren Hills Regional) placed first in the 50 free (22.73). Junior
Troy Buglio (Toms River, N.J./Toms River East) won the 500 free (5:25.17). Sophomore
Evan Marine (Forked River, N.J./Lacey Twp.) touched first in the 100 back (1:02.63).
The 200 IM team of Schrils, Marine,
Donado Dervishi (Garfield, N.J./Garfield) and
Eric Tracey (Newton, N.J./Kittatinny Regional) posted a winning time of 1:43.35.
The team of Buglio,
Bobby Boyton (Sewell, N.J./Clearview Regional),
Alex Carpenter (Jackson, N.J./Jackson Memorial) and
Nicolai Robinson (Matawan, N.J./Old Bridge) placed first in the 200 free relay (1:25.36).
William Paterson will go on the road to face Sarah Lawrence on Wednesday, Dec. 12, at 7:00 p.m.
